One of the most common issues with composite doors is that they get unbalanced over time. This can make it difficult to open or close them. This can be due to many factors, including changes in humidity or temperature. Fortunately, these problems are easily solved by locksmiths.

Another issue that is common to composite doors is that the locking mechanism may get stuck or misaligned. This can be frustrating, inconvenient and even dangerous. To resolve this it is essential to grease the lock mechanism. This will keep the lock mechanism from getting stuck or misaligned and will allow you to unlock your door.

There are several ways to lubricate your Euro Cylinder or mortise lock, or night latch. It is recommended to first clean the locks to get rid of dirt and debris. Then, you can use silicone grease lubricant or lubricant. You should also keep them lubricated every six months to ensure their condition.

In addition to lubricating your lock, it is also important to ensure that there aren't any obstructions in the mechanism. This can cause the lock to malfunction and can even cause damage to the door frame. Contact a locksmith right away if you notice any problems with your lock.

If you are unable to turn your key on your composite door it could be due to an issue with the cylinder. If it's a problem with the mechanism, you may have to replace the entire multipoint locking system in your uPVC door. This is a strip that runs the length of the door and contains multiple locking points. It is operated by turning the handle or lifting the handle. A locksmith can supply and install a new mechanism for your composite door in the event that it is broken.

If your uPVC doors are difficult to lock or shut there may be a problem with the multipoint locking system or the central gearbox. These are the parts that control the various locking points on your composite door and can cause problems if they become damaged or worn. Contact a locksmith as quickly as you notice an issue with your composite door's inner mechanism.

A damaged lock can make it difficult to open your composite door and could increase the risk of warping. Most often, this is due to the accumulation of debris in the mechanism. It can be resolved by cleaning and lubricating the door cylinder and lock. To ensure that the lock operates smoothly, it's a great idea to oil it every six months.
